Alfred Hind
| Full name: | Alfred Ernest Hind |
| Born: | 7th April 1878, Preston, Lancashire, England |
| Died: | 21st March 1947, Oadby, Leicestershire, England |
| Batting: | Right-hand batter |
| Bowling: | Right-arm medium pace |
| Education: | Uppingham School; Trinity Hall College, Cambridge |
| Other Sports: | Rugby Union (Cambridge University - blue 1900), Leicester, Nottingham, England - 2 caps 1905-06 - and Lions. Athletics (Cambridge University, blue 1899-00, 100 yards); in 1900 and 1901 he twice set a new UK record of 9.8 sec for 100 yards, but neither record was ratified. |
| Biography: | Solicitor, Bray and Bray, Leicester (1920) |
| Teams: | Cambridge University (Main FC: 1898-1901); Nottinghamshire (Main FC: 1901); All teams |
